Meng Yan's Transformation
Chapter 634 Pay off the debt
The July wind blew into the classroom of Class 1, Grade 1 of a regular high school through the window, but instead of bringing any coolness, it stirred up the anxiety at the edges of the exam papers.
"The results are coming out soon." Class monitor Liu Ziqi's voice was like a pebble thrown into boiling water. Liu Mingjun in the front row suddenly looked up, sweat beads on the back of his neck leaving dark stains on his blue shirt. Last night he dreamed that the function graph on the math test paper turned into a ferocious monster. At this moment, his Adam's apple bobbed as he swallowed. Xu Xiaqing cut the eraser into small pieces, then kneaded them back into their original shape one by one. His eyelashes cast uneasy shadows under his eyes. Dong Hanmei's fingernails unconsciously slid back and forth in the marks on the desk—the tally marks left last year were already blurred, but the new marks were getting deeper and deeper.
The lights of the evening self-study session resembled a frozen lake. Zhan Mengyan sat in the back row of the classroom, her pen tracing unintentional lines on the paper.
The chirping of crickets outside the window came in waves, and the day the final exam results would be released hung like a Damocles' sword over her head. Zhan Mengyan stared at the last big question on her math test, but the formulas and symbols twisted into the strange gaze of a photo studio photographer—a few weeks ago, when she and her sister were taking pictures together, the photographer had secretly taken many photos of them, leaving her with an IOU for the photo studio. She was determined to pay off the debt as soon as possible.
"Teacher, I need to ask for leave from tomorrow's evening self-study session." Zhan Mengyan clutched the leave slip as she walked toward the office, her nails digging into her palms.
The homeroom teacher looked Zhan Mengyan up and down from above her glasses: "Going to work part-time at the cannery again?"
As Zhan Mengyan nodded, she heard her own voice tremble: "I have some debts to deal with before summer vacation, and I must pay them off."
"Zhan Mengyan, I hope you can make the most of your summer vacation by doing part-time jobs. You'll be a sophomore next semester. Some classes in our school are on a two-year program, meaning students can take the college entrance exam in their sophomore year. The workload will be very heavy. If you skip evening self-study every day to do part-time jobs, your body won't be able to handle it. You won't have the energy to study, how will you get good grades? How will you take the college entrance exam? If your college entrance exam results are poor, it will be a huge loss for you. You'll have wasted your high school years. I'm giving you leave today, so think carefully about what you should do for your future college entrance exams..."
As Zhan Mengyan walked into the office, the earnest words of her homeroom teacher still echoed in her ears.
When Zhan Mengyan arrived at the cannery, she took a deep breath the moment the iron gate closed, locking her homeroom teacher's advice and her anxiety about her grades into the locker.
The night shift at the cannery starts at 8:00 PM. The assembly line conveyor belt never stops. Zhan Mengyan's rubber gloves are soaked with sugar syrup as she hurriedly labels the canned yellow peaches. Steam blurs her goggles as she counts the cans: when she finishes labeling the thirty-eighth can, she thinks of trigonometric functions; when she gets to the eighty-sixth can, she silently recites English words...
During a shift change at 2:00 AM, she curled up in a corner of the break room. She remembered the notice on the school bulletin board: report cards would be released tomorrow. "When the final grades are released, summer vacation will start, and I'll have plenty of time to do part-time jobs," Zhan Mengyan thought excitedly, before quickly extinguishing her excitement.
The herbal tea her coworkers offered burned her throat, and she suddenly laughed out loud: "What if I fail the exam? The teacher won't give me any more leave, and Dad and Mom will make me drop out of school again. I'll feel so bad for Yingying, who's working far away and cares about me..."
In the darkest hour before dawn, Zhan Mengyan dragged her leaden legs out of the factory area. The neon sign of the photo studio loomed faintly in the morning mist, like a gentle threat. In her swaying dream on the factory bus, she saw herself in front of the honor roll, then saw the young photographer tearing up an IOU, then saw her parents secretly discussing making her drop out of school…
As the first rays of sunlight pierced through the clouds, Zhan Mengyan counted her sweat-soaked wages three times, feeling that she was still a little short of that amount.
